Introduction

Loneliness is a common experience; possibly 80% of them below 18 yrs . old and you can forty% of grownups more 65 yrs old report being alone within the very least both [1–3], with quantities of loneliness gradually shrinking from the center mature decades, following increasing within the old age (we.elizabeth., ?70 many years) . Loneliness are just understood public separation, not that have purpose societal separation. Someone can also be alive relatively unmarried lives and never feel lonely, and you may having said that, they can real time an ostensibly steeped personal lives and you will getting alone however. Loneliness is described as a distressing feeling that include the fresh perception you to your societal demands commonly getting found because of the numbers otherwise particularly the quality of a person’s public dating [dos, 4–6]. Loneliness is typically measured by inquiring individuals respond to affairs such as those on frequently used UCLA Loneliness Measure : “I feel isolated,” “There are anyone I am able to communicate with,” and “I’m element of a group of family.” The result is a continuum out-of results one vary from extremely socially connected to highly lonely.

We can perform effect alone, and you can loneliness is actually an equal possibility renter for a good reason. We have posited one to loneliness ‘s the personal equivalent of bodily problems, cravings, and you will hunger; the pain of social disconnection therefore the desire for food and you will thirst getting personal union convince the constant maintenance and you can formation out-of public connectivity necessary toward success your family genes [8, 9]. Feelings out of loneliness essentially flourish in encouraging relationship otherwise reconnection which have someone else pursuing the geographical relocation or bereavement, including, and therefore diminishing or abolishing thinking away from societal separation. Getting possibly fifteen–30% of the standard society, yet not, loneliness are a long-term county [10, 11]. Left unattended, loneliness have serious consequences to have knowledge, feelings, decisions, and you may health. Here, i review mental and physical health consequences regarding recognized personal isolation and then present systems for these outcomes in the context of a product that takes into account the fresh new intellectual, mental, and you can behavioral functions from loneliness.

Loneliness Issues to own Future health and Mortality

An increasing body regarding longitudinal research indicates one to loneliness forecasts improved morbidity and you may mortality [12–19]. The consequences off loneliness frequently accrue through the years so you’re able to speeds psychological aging . Such as, loneliness has been proven showing a serving–reaction connection with heart health chance inside the younger adulthood . More how many dimensions occasions where users had been alone (i.elizabeth., youngsters, adolescence, and at twenty six yrs old), the greater number of their quantity of heart health dangers (i.elizabeth., Bmi, systolic blood pressure levels (SBP), overall, and HDL cholesterol, glycated hemoglobin attention, limitation clean air use). Similarly, loneliness is actually associated with increased systolic blood pressure levels in a society-dependent try away from middle-aged grownups , and you will a take-right up examination of such same anybody indicated that a persistent trait-such as for example aspect of loneliness expidited the rate regarding blood pressure levels improve more than good cuatro-12 months pursue-up period . Loneliness accrual outcomes also are obvious into the a study of death regarding the Health and Old age Analysis; all-lead to mortality over a beneficial 4-year follow-right up are predicted by loneliness, as well as the effect try greater into the chronically than simply situationally alone grownups . Penninx et al. showed that loneliness forecast every-lead to death throughout a beneficial 31-day go after-up just after managing to possess age, sex, persistent sickness, alcoholic drinks use, smoking, self-ranked fitness, and you may practical limits. Sugisawa mais aussi al. plus discovered a critical effect of loneliness towards death more a beneficial 3-12 months months, and this perception is actually informed me by the chronic problems, functional standing, and you can notice-rated wellness. Among women in the latest Federal Health and Diet Survey, chronic high frequency loneliness (>three days/times at each from a couple measurement instances regarding 8 ages apart) is prospectively with the incident cardiovascular state (CHD) over an excellent 19-12 months realize-upwards during the analyses one adjusted to possess years, race, socioeconomic standing, relationship reputation, and aerobic exposure factors . Depressive symptoms was basically associated with loneliness along with adverse wellness consequences, but loneliness went on in order to anticipate CHD in these feminine once plus managing getting depressive symptoms. Fundamentally, loneliness has also been shown to increase chance to possess cardio mortality; people who claimed usually being alone exhibited rather greater risk than simply people who reported never uk dating sites becoming alone . In share, thoughts from loneliness mark increased chance to own morbidity and you can death, an occurrence you to probably reflects the newest societal essence of our species.
